Web31 okt. 2024 · An I-beam is made up of two horizontal planes (called flanges) that are joined together by a single vertical component, forming the capital letter “I” in a cross-section. Due to its narrow cross-section (also known as the web), I-beams can fulfil their load-bearing duties with the least amount of material. WebRegarding the detector positions in the sinogram which range from for example -40 to 40 degrees, when the source is at 0 degrees for the fan beam rotation assuming the source is placed horizontally at the beginning (along positive x axis), is -40 attributed to the uppermost detector or the lowest? dyson chosen marketWeb11 sep. 2024 · Yes, we need to calculate M.I to identify the major axis. Axis about which M.I is maximum we will call it as Major axis and other orthogonal axis as minor axis.
